Summary:
There have been lots of issues with user experience related to authentication
and its help messages.

Just one of it:
certs are configured to be used for authentication and they are invalid but the `hg cloud auth`
command will provide help message about the certs but then ask to copy and
paste a token from the code about interactive token obtaining.

Another thing, is certs are configired to use, it was not hard to
set up a token for Scm Daemon that can be still on tokens even if cloud
sync uses certs.

Now it is possible with `hg auth -t <token>` command

Now it should be more cleaner and all the messages should be cleaner as well.

Also certs related help message has been improved.

Also all tests were cleaned up from the authentication except for the main
test. This is to simplify the tests.
